Understanding Cryptocurrencies

Cryptocurrencies are digital or virtual currencies underpinned by cryptologic systems. They permit secure online payments while not the utilization of third-party intermediaries. “Crypto” refers to the assorted encoding algorithms and cryptologic techniques that safeguard these entries, like elliptical curve encoding, public-private key pairs, and hashing functions.

Cryptocurrencies are often strip-mined or purchased from cryptocurrency exchanges. Not all e-Commerce sites permit purchases of victimization cryptocurrencies. Cryptocurrencies, even standard ones like Bitcoin, are hardly used for retail transactions. However, the skyrocketing worth of cryptocurrencies has created them standard as mercantilism instruments. To a restricted extent, they’re additionally used for cross-border transfers.

Key merits

  • Cryptocurrencies represent a replacement, decentralized paradigm for cash. During this system, centralized intermediaries, like banks and financial establishments, don’t seem to be necessary to enforce trust and police transactions between 2 parties. Thus, a system with cryptocurrencies eliminates the likelihood of one purpose of failure, like an oversized bank, setting off a cascade of crises around the world, like the one that was triggered in 2008 by the failure of establishments within us.
  • Cryptocurrencies promise to form it easier to transfer funds directly between 2 parties, while not the requirement for a trustworthy third party sort of a bank or a MasterCard company. Such decentralized transfers are secured by the utilization of public keys and personal keys and completely different styles of incentive systems, like proof of labor or proof of stake.
  • Because they are not using third-party intermediaries, cryptocurrency transfers between 2 transacting parties are quicker as compared to plain cash transfers.   • The remittal economy is testing one every of cryptocurrency’s most outstanding use cases. Currently, c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in function as intermediate currencies to contour cash transfers across borders. Thus, an order currency is a born-again to Bitcoin (or another cryptocurrency), transferred across borders and, later, born-again to the destination order currency. This technique streamlines the money transfer method and makes it cheaper.
